What is Reef Safe Sunscreen?

Reef-safe sunscreen is designed to be environmentally friendly and safe for coral reefs. Unlike traditional sunscreens, which often contain chemicals like oxybenzone and octinoxate, reef-safe sunscreens use natural, biodegradable ingredients that are less harmful to marine life.

One of the key ingredients in reef-safe sunscreen is zinc oxide, which provides broad-spectrum protection against UVA and UVB rays. Another popular ingredient is titanium dioxide, which also offers excellent sun protection. These ingredients are less likely to be absorbed by the skin and can be more easily broken down by the environment.

Why is Reef Safe Sunscreen Important in Hawaii?

Hawaii is home to some of the most vibrant and diverse coral reefs in the world. These reefs are not only a source of beauty and wonder but also a vital part of the local ecosystem. Unfortunately, traditional sunscreen chemicals have been found to be harmful to coral reefs, leading to bleaching and even death in some cases.

By using reef-safe sunscreen, you can help protect these precious ecosystems and ensure that future generations can enjoy the beauty of Hawaii’s coral reefs. It’s a small but significant step you can take to make a positive impact on the environment.

How to Choose the Right Reef Safe Sunscreen for Hawaii

With so many reef-safe sunscreen options available, it can be challenging to choose the right one for your needs. Here are some tips to help you make an informed decision:

  • Look for the “reef-safe” label: This is the most straightforward way to identify a sunscreen that is safe for coral reefs.

  • Check the ingredients: Avoid sunscreens that contain oxybenzone, octinoxate, and other harmful chemicals. Instead, look for natural ingredients like zinc oxide and titanium dioxide.

  • Consider your skin type: Some reef-safe sunscreens are oil-free and water-resistant, making them ideal for those with sensitive skin or those who enjoy water activities.

  • Read reviews: Look for reviews from other travelers who have used the sunscreen in Hawaii to get an idea of its effectiveness and ease of use.

How to Apply Reef Safe Sunscreen Properly

Applying reef-safe sunscreen correctly is just as important as choosing the right product. Here are some tips to ensure you’re using it effectively:

  • Apply sunscreen 15 to 30 minutes before going outside to allow it to absorb into the skin.

  • Use a generous amount of sunscreen to cover all exposed skin, including the ears, nose, and feet.

  • Reapply sunscreen every two hours, or more frequently if you’re swimming or sweating.
